WebThe Java platform defines a set of APIs spanning major security areas, including cryptography, public key infrastructure, authentication, secure communication, and access control. These APIs enable developers to easily integrate security mechanisms into their application code.

The PKI root of trust and all of the cryptographic keys must be properly … Webthe framework that defines and supports cryptographic services for which providers supply implementations. This framework includes packages such as java.security, javax.crypto, javax.crypto.spec, and javax.crypto.interfaces. the actual providers such as Sun, SunRsaSign, SunJCE, which contain the actual cryptographic implementations.
